html5滑動(dòng)選擇時(shí)間(html中滑動(dòng)框怎樣設(shè)置大小)
1創(chuàng)建兩個(gè)html文件,一個(gè)test一個(gè)test22打開test頁面,在里面創(chuàng)建一個(gè)div,并給其添加onmousedown與move方法3打開后我們發(fā)現(xiàn)是一個(gè)棕綠的頁面4定義兩個(gè)變量,startx為鼠標(biāo)按下的坐標(biāo),endx為鼠標(biāo)移動(dòng)的坐標(biāo)5實(shí)現(xiàn)鼠標(biāo)點(diǎn)擊執(zhí)行的down方法,在里面通過clientX獲得鼠標(biāo)按下坐標(biāo),并賦值給;日期和時(shí)間類型HTML5 擁有多個(gè)可供選取日期和時(shí)間的新輸入類型date 選取日月年 month 選取月年 week 選取周和年 time 選取時(shí)間小時(shí)和分鐘datetime 選取時(shí)間日月年UTC 時(shí)間datetimelocal 選取時(shí)間日月年本地時(shí)間search 類型用于搜索域,比如站點(diǎn);在系統(tǒng)設(shè)置里的按鍵設(shè)置里面增加按鍵亮度調(diào)節(jié)的選項(xiàng),或者可以是否跟隨屏幕亮度自動(dòng)改變可以使用第三方軟件實(shí)現(xiàn)這個(gè)功能;左右滑動(dòng)是由觸摸事件定義的,觸摸事件touch會(huì)在用戶手指放在屏幕上面的時(shí)候在屏幕上滑動(dòng)的時(shí)候或者是從屏幕上移開的時(shí)候觸發(fā)下面具體說明touchstart事件當(dāng)手指觸摸屏幕時(shí)候觸發(fā),即使已經(jīng)有一個(gè)手指放在屏幕上也會(huì)觸發(fā)touchmove事件當(dāng)手指在屏幕上滑動(dòng)的時(shí)候連續(xù)地觸發(fā)在這個(gè)事件發(fā)生期間,調(diào);affect1, 1上下滾動(dòng) 2幕布式 3左右滾動(dòng)4淡入淡出 time 5000, 間隔時(shí)間 speed500, 動(dòng)畫快慢 dot_texttrue,按鈕上有無序列號(hào) var opts=$extenddefaults,optionsvar $this=$thisvar ool=$quotltdiv class=#39dot#39ltpltpltdivquotvar $box;給裝兩個(gè)分類的div加上overflowscroll試試,分類內(nèi)部的元素floatleft。
親,請使用SUI3框架寫,直接調(diào)用就可以了 網(wǎng)址附上圖片知道老是把鏈接判定為違規(guī) 效果;lthtml02425至此基于Chrome瀏覽器,對滑動(dòng)控件的美化已全部完成最后只剩下多瀏覽器的兼容問題了35 實(shí)現(xiàn)多瀏覽器兼容如果要兼容Firefox瀏覽器,只需要把上述css代碼中的 webkitsliderrunnabletrack 替換為 mozrangetrack ,就可以完成對軌道的美化了;jQuery UI 官方插件中有個(gè) Slider你可以自定義 最大值,最小值,滑動(dòng)時(shí)的事件,停止時(shí)的事件等等,應(yīng)該就是你想要的;1如果是div設(shè)置了滾動(dòng)條導(dǎo)致滑動(dòng)不順暢,可以在css中加入webkitoverflowscrolling touch2如果是幻燈片,可以用swiper插件一類的3盡量用css3開啟GPU加速css隨便哪里加個(gè)transformtransition3d0,0,0,用transformtranslatex,y代替mairgin或者top4減少滑動(dòng)過程中的運(yùn)動(dòng)DOM。
普通banner或信息列表可以用IScroll上下左右均可滑動(dòng) 頁面滑動(dòng)切換的話建議使用jquery mobile,實(shí)現(xiàn)如下事件,進(jìn)行changepage swipe劃動(dòng)一秒內(nèi)水平拖拽大于30PX,同時(shí)縱向拖曳???0px的事件發(fā)生時(shí)觸發(fā) swipeleft左劃;用jQuery 的 animate方法,動(dòng)態(tài)改變數(shù)據(jù)表格的高度,這樣應(yīng)該可以實(shí)現(xiàn)。
要同時(shí)顯示就要同時(shí)觸發(fā)動(dòng)畫,可以在HTML上把這3個(gè)box組織在一處,放在同一個(gè)父容器里,再用CSS同時(shí)觸發(fā)示例ltdiv class=quotfatherquotltdiv class=quotbox1quot05sltdivltdiv class=quotbox2quot1sltdivltdiv class=quotbox3quot2sltdivltdiv同時(shí)觸發(fā)的CSSfatherhover box1 * box1動(dòng)畫;回答我都想要呢,誰有這個(gè)??;H5單頁面手勢滑屏切換是采用HTML5 觸摸事件Touch 和 CSS3動(dòng)畫Transform,Transition來實(shí)現(xiàn)的1實(shí)現(xiàn)原理假設(shè)有5個(gè)頁面,每個(gè)頁面占屏幕100%寬,則創(chuàng)建一個(gè)DIV容器viewport,將其寬度width 設(shè)置為500%,然后將5個(gè)頁面裝入容器中,并讓這5個(gè)頁面平分整個(gè)容器,最后將容器的默認(rèn)位置設(shè)置為0,overflow。
掃描二維碼推送至手機(jī)訪問。
版權(quán)聲明:本文由飛速云SEO網(wǎng)絡(luò)優(yōu)化推廣發(fā)布,如需轉(zhuǎn)載請注明出處。